Here is rough description of a typical day in the life of Duke @ 5 mnths
6-6.30 wake
7-7.30 bottle. cereal @ 8-8.30
8.30-9 sleepies
10.30-11.30 wake and Play
11.30-12 Bottle
12.30 Pumpkin followed by apple
1pm sleepies
2-2.30 wake and play time
3.3o- 4 Bottle
4-5 nap (sometimes won't want one but needs it)
5pm Pumpkin followed by apple
5.30 duke loves us reading him books
6-6.30 Bath, bottle bed by 7pm
11pm-1.30am Bottle
